The TDA8943SF/N1,112 is a high-quality audio amplifier integrated circuit (IC) designed and manufactured by NXP Semiconductors. This IC is part of NXP's renowned audio processing product line, which is well-known for its reliability, performance, and innovation. The TDA8943SF/N1,112 is specifically engineered to deliver exceptional sound quality with high efficiency, making it an ideal choice for a wide range of audio applications.
Key Features
- Amplifier Type: Class B
- Output Power: The IC can deliver up to 1 x 7W of output power, making it suitable for small to medium-sized audio systems.
- Supply Voltage: It operates within a supply voltage range of 6V to 12V, providing flexibility in various power supply scenarios.
- Load Impedance: Optimized for loads of 8 Ohms, which is standard for many speakers.
- Audio Quality: The TDA8943SF/N1,112 ensures low harmonic distortion and low noise, contributing to a clear and precise audio output.
- Protection Features: It includes several protection features such as thermal protection, short-circuit protection, and overvoltage protection to ensure long-term reliability.
- Package: The IC comes in a 9-SIL (Single In-Line) package, which simplifies the PCB design and allows for easy integration into various electronic devices.
Applications
The TDA8943SF/N1,112 is versatile and can be used in a variety of audio applications. These include:
- Television sets
- Mini and micro audio systems
- Powered speakers
- Personal computers
- Portable audio devices
